    /**
     * A Windows SID is a numeric identifier used to represent Windows
     * accounts. SIDs are commonly represented using a textual format such as
     * <tt>S-1-5-21-1496946806-2192648263-3843101252-1029</tt> but they may
     * also be resolved to yield the name of the associated Windows account
     * such as <tt>Administrators</tt> or <tt>MYDOM\alice</tt>.

     * and workgroups.
     * <p>
     * <font color="#800000"><i>Important: all SMB URLs that represent
     * workgroups, servers, shares, or directories require a trailing slash '/'.
     * </i></font>
     * <p>
     * When using the <tt>java.net.URL</tt> class with
     * 'smb1://' URLs it is necessary to first call the static
     * <tt>jcifs.smb1.Config.registerSmbURLHandler();</tt> method. This is required
     * to register the SMB protocol handler.
